编写函数,根据长、宽、高之值计算长方体体积。要求设置默认参数如果没有提供参数,体积返回0
时间: 2024-04-29 19:22:34 浏览: 100
好的,这是一个简单的编程问题,我可以帮你解决。请看下面的 Python 代码:
```python
def calculate_volume(length=0, width=0, height=0):
"""
计算长方体的体积
:param length: 长,默认为0
:param width: 宽,默认为0
:param height: 高,默认为0
:return: 长方体的体积
"""
return length * width * height
# 测试
print(calculate_volume(3, 4, 5)) # 输出:60
print(calculate_volume(width=5, length=3)) # 输出:0
```
这个函数可以根据长、宽、高之值计算长方体的体积,同时也设置了默认值为0。如果某些参数没有提供,则默认为0,函数会返回0。
相关问题
编写函数,根据长、宽、高之值计算长方体体积。要求设置默认参数如果没有提供参数,体积返回0.
好的,这个问题很简单。下面是一个可以计算长方体体积的Python函数。
```python
def calc_volume(length=0, width=0, height=0):
volume = length * width * height
return volume
```
如果没有提供任何参数,默认的体积值为0。如果要计算一个长为5、宽为3、高为2的长方体的体积,你可以这样调用函数:
```python
result = calc_volume(5, 3, 2)
print(result)
```
这个函数的输出结果将会是30。
1.编写函数,根据长、宽、高之值计算长方体体积。要求设置默认参数如果没有提供参数,体积返回0
好的,这是一个计算长方体体积的问题。以下是函数的代码,要使用默认参数,请输入两个参数即可。
```
def calc_volume(length=0, width=0, height=0):
if length and width and height:
return length * width * height
else:
return 0
```
请注意这里的函数参数都设置了默认值,这样即使没有提供参数,函数也可以正确地返回体积为0。
阅读全文